use super::{arg_dword, HostState, Registry, StubFn, Win32Error};
use crate::emulator::{Cpu, Mmu};
const DRV_LOAD: u32 = 0x0001;
const DRV_ENABLE: u32 = 0x0002;
const DRV_OPEN: u32 = 0x0003;
const DRV_CLOSE: u32 = 0x0004;
const DRV_DISABLE: u32 = 0x0005;
const DRV_FREE: u32 = 0x0006;
const DRV_CONFIGURE: u32 = 0x0007;
const DRV_QUERYCONFIGURE: u32 = 0x0008;
const DRV_INSTALL: u32 = 0x0009;
const DRV_REMOVE: u32 = 0x000A;
const DRVCNF_OK: u32 = 1;
pub fn register(registry: &mut Registry) {
registry.register(
"winmm.dll",
"DefDriverProc",
stub_def_driver_proc as StubFn,
5,
);
registry.register("winmm.dll", "timeGetTime", stub_time_get_time as StubFn, 0);
registry.register(
"winmm.dll",
"GetDriverModuleHandle",
stub_get_driver_module_handle as StubFn,
1,
);
}
fn stub_def_driver_proc(
cpu: &mut Cpu,
mmu: &mut Mmu,
_state: &mut HostState,
_registry: &Registry,
) -> Result<u32, Win32Error> {
let _id =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 0)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("DefDriverProc", t))?;
let _hdrvr =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 1)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("DefDriverProc", t))?;
let msg =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 2)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("DefDriverProc", t))?;
let _l1 =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 3)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("DefDriverProc", t))?;
let _l2 =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 4)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("DefDriverProc", t))?;
Ok(match msg {
DRV_CONFIGURE => DRVCNF_OK,
DRV_LOAD | DRV_FREE | DRV_OPEN | DRV_CLOSE | DRV_ENABLE | DRV_DISABLE
| DRV_QUERYCONFIGURE | DRV_INSTALL | DRV_REMOVE => 0,
_ => 0,
})
}
fn stub_time_get_time(
_cpu: &mut Cpu,
_mmu: &mut Mmu,
state: &mut HostState,
_registry: &Registry,
) -> Result<u32, Win32Error> {
state.tick = state.tick.wrapping_add(1);
Ok(state.tick)
}
fn stub_get_driver_module_handle(
cpu: &mut Cpu,
mmu: &mut Mmu,
state: &mut HostState,
_registry: &Registry,
) -> Result<u32, Win32Error> {
let _hdrvr = arg_dword(cpu, mmu, 0)
.map_err(|t| crate::win32::trap_to_win32_local("GetDriverModuleHandle", t))?;
Ok(state.primary_module_base)
}
